## Font Vendoring Env Vars

Glyphbox vendors all third-party fonts at build time. No CDN fetches at runtime — legal requirement. `FONT_MANIFEST_PATH` lists licensed families. `FONT_CACHE_DIR` holds vendored binaries; wipe it when licenses change. `FONT_SUBSET=true` strips unused glyphs, cuts bundle size ~60%. Builds fail if a font isn't in the manifest. That's intentional; don't bypass it. The vendoring tool authenticates to the license registry with a token set on the following line.

sealed setting: ARCHIVE_KEY3=8d0

**Vendor note: Gatemark turnstile counters, Holloway Stadium**

Gatemark supplies and services all turnstile counter units. Do not open units yourself; warranty voids on broken seals. Counts sync hourly to the Holloway ops dashboard. Discrepancies over 2% per gate get logged and reported same day. Firmware updates are vendor-scheduled only — decline any on-site request without a work order. Report faults, sync failures, or seal damage to the Gatemark service desk at the address below.

escalation mailbox, yafog-kafof: eliok@xolmarcloud.local

Before archiving a cold storage bucket in Glacierette, detach all plugin hooks. Run the freeze job, confirm checksum parity, then revoke scoped tokens. Do not delete manifests; the Vexhall recovery service reads them during account restoration. If the bucket owner's account is locked, trigger the recovery flow from the Opsgate console, not the plugin API. Archival completes within 20 minutes. Plugins must tolerate 404s on frozen objects. To unseal the restore job, use the passphrase below.

vault phrase of fawig-yagug = tamix-norys-ulaix-joreth-druius-jorael-briax-prair-lamael-caseth-brivan-lamius-istius

## Step 4: Enable the Bloom Filter Layer

Plugin authors migrating to Quillstore 3.x must account for the new bloom filter that sits in front of the key-value store. Negative lookups now short-circuit before reaching your plugin's fetch hook, so any side effects you relied on during misses will no longer fire. Test both hit and miss paths explicitly. The filter ships with the configuration shown below.

deployment values, kajep-kageg:
[praix]
host = praix.paliqcorp.corp
user = praix_svc
database = praix_prod